"Time Reversal Violation"
The KTeV experiment at Fermilab has recently announced
new
results on time reversal (CP) violation in neutral kaon
decays. This talk will concentrate on these new
results
which include the observation of a new and novel time
reversal violation effect in the decay K0L -> pi pi e
e and the
new measurement of epsilon prime in the two pion decays.
The epsilon prime measurement indicates that time reversal
violation in kaon decays is due to the weak interaction
rather
than to a new "superweak" interaction of nature.
Other results of
the KTeV experiment will be discussed, time permitting.
